Common Misconceptions about Rigging

The concern that slot machines are rigged often stems from players’ personal experiences, particularly when they have endured long losing streaks. This can lead to the belief that the machines are manipulated to prevent wins. However, it’s important to clarify that most reputable casinos use RNG technology and adhere to strict regulatory standards that prevent the possibility of rigging. Each spin is based solely on chance, not on any pre-determined outcomes. Such transparency in operations helps to alleviate fears surrounding the integrity of the games.

Another misconception involves the belief that specific machines are “hot” or “cold,” suggesting that players can time their bets strategically based on machine performance. In reality, each spin’s outcome is random; there’s no correlation between past and future results. Casinos do not alter these odds; therefore, players have no way to predict or influence when a machine might pay out. This understanding emphasizes the importance of treating slot gaming as a game of chance, rather than a calculated strategy.

Furthermore, the idea that casinos can control when a machine pays out is a significant misunderstanding. Casinos can operate machines with a set return-to-player (RTP) percentage, but this is predetermined and cannot be manipulated on a whim. The Role of Regulations and Testing

Regulatory bodies govern the gaming industry to establish standards that maintain fairness and transparency. Testing laboratories conduct thorough examinations of slot machines, ensuring that the RNGs function correctly and that the machines adhere to their designated RTP percentages. These regulations provide assurance to players that they are engaging in fair gameplay.
